Understanding the Core Mechanics of Crash Games
At its heart, a crash game presents a continuously increasing multiplier. The game begins with a small multiplier, typically starting at 1x, and this number steadily climbs. Players place a bet before each round begins, and the goal is to cash out – or ‘collect’ – their winnings before the multiplier suddenly crashes. The longer you wait to cash out, the higher the potential payout, but the greater the risk of losing your initial bet. This fundamental gameplay loop creates a compelling dynamic driven by anticipation and calculated risk. Successful players aren’t simply relying on luck; they’re employing strategies based on probability, observation, and self-discipline. The random number generator (RNG) employed by reputable platforms ensures fairness and unpredictability in determining when the crash will occur.
The Role of the Random Number Generator (RNG)
The integrity of any online casino game, and particularly one based on chance like a crash game, rests on the reliability of its Random Number Generator. A robust RNG ensures that each round is independent and unbiased, meaning that past results have no bearing on future outcomes. Reputable gaming platforms subject their RNGs to rigorous testing and auditing by independent third-party organizations. These audits verify that the RNG generates truly random numbers and that the game’s payout percentage aligns with stated figures. Without a trustworthy RNG, the fairness of the game is compromised, and players have no guarantee of a legitimate chance to win. Players should always seek out platforms that publicly display their RNG certification.

The Importance of Bankroll Management
Effective bankroll management is paramount in any form of gambling, but it’s particularly crucial in the fast-paced world of crash games. Determining a fixed amount you’re willing to lose before you begin playing is the first step. Never exceed this limit, regardless of whether you’re on a winning or losing streak. A common rule of thumb is to wager only a small percentage of your bankroll on each round – typically between 1% and 5%. This helps to cushion against potential losses and allows you to endure extended periods of unfavorable outcomes. Avoid the temptation to increase your bets impulsively after a win or to ‘chase’ losses by doubling down in an attempt to recoup your funds quickly. Disciplined bankroll management is the cornerstone of responsible and potentially profitable crash game play.

How Provably Fair Technology Works
Provably fair systems typically rely on a combination of client-side seeding, server seeding, and cryptographic hashing. The client provides a random seed, the server provides another, and these are combined to generate a final seed used to determine the game’s outcome. Hashing algorithms, such as SHA-256, are used to encrypt the seeds, making them irreversible and preventing manipulation. Players can then independently verify the fairness of the outcome by using the provided seeds and hashing algorithms to recreate the game’s results. This verification process confirms that the outcome was indeed random and that the platform did not interfere with the game’s integrity. The mathematical principles behind provably fair systems are complex, but the core goal is to provide an auditable and verifiable record of each game round.

Beyond the Crash: Responsible Gaming and Staying Safe
While crash games can offer an exciting form of entertainment, it is vital to prioritize responsible gaming practices. Setting strict limits on both time and money spent is paramount. Recognizing the warning signs of problem gambling – such as chasing losses, neglecting personal responsibilities, or experiencing emotional distress – is essential, and seeking help if needed is a sign of strength, not weakness. Many resources are available to support individuals struggling with gambling addiction, including self-exclusion programs and counseling services. Remember that gambling should be viewed as a form of entertainment, not a source of income.
